出版時間:1999-08 出版社:清華大學出版社
內(nèi)容概要
內(nèi)容簡介
本書是中國計算機軟件專業(yè)技術(shù)數(shù)據(jù)庫技術(shù)(中級)水平考試指定用書,根據(jù)1999年度最新版考試
大綱編寫。通過本級考試的考生可以具有計算機數(shù)據(jù)庫應(yīng)用程序開發(fā)和數(shù)據(jù)管理的能力,具有相當工程
師的實際工作能力和業(yè)務(wù)水平。
全書共9章,內(nèi)容包括:計算機基本原理、操作系統(tǒng)、數(shù)據(jù)庫基本原理、查詢語言SQL與數(shù)據(jù)庫設(shè)
計、數(shù)據(jù)庫管理系統(tǒng)ORACLE,SYBASE,INFORMIX及它們的工具軟件、數(shù)據(jù)庫系統(tǒng)的實施與維護、數(shù)
據(jù)庫技術(shù)的發(fā)展動向等。
本書為參加中國計算機軟件專業(yè)技術(shù)水平考試數(shù)據(jù)庫技術(shù)中級水平考試的必讀教材,也適用于從
事數(shù)據(jù)庫技術(shù)的工程技術(shù)人員作為培訓教材。
書籍目錄
目錄
第1章 計算機基本原理
1.1 計算機系統(tǒng)的組成
1.1.1 計算機硬件結(jié)構(gòu)
1.1.2 計算機軟件系統(tǒng)
1.2 計算機工作原理
1.2.1 計算機中數(shù)據(jù)的表示
1.2.2 中央處理器CPU
1.2.3 存儲器
1.2.4 輸入設(shè)備
1.2.5 輸出設(shè)備
1.3 計算機體系結(jié)構(gòu)
1.3.1 體系結(jié)構(gòu)的發(fā)展
1.3.2 計算機體系結(jié)構(gòu)的分類
1.3.3 指令系統(tǒng)
1.3.4 存儲系統(tǒng)
1.3.5 1/O通道
1.3.6 總線結(jié)構(gòu)
1.3.7 并行處理技術(shù)
第2章 操作系統(tǒng)
2.1 操作系統(tǒng)基本功能
2.1.1 操作系統(tǒng)基本概念
2.1.2 操作系統(tǒng)的分類
2.1.3 操作系統(tǒng)的功能
2.2 UNIX操作系統(tǒng)的特點與使用
2.2.1 UNIX操作系統(tǒng)概述
2.2.2 UNIX基本操作
2.2.3 UNIX常用命令
2.2.4 文件系統(tǒng)的使用
2.2.5 shell和Cshell命令解釋器
2.2.6 UNIX系統(tǒng)維護
2.3 WindowsNT操作系統(tǒng)
2.3.1 WindowsNT基本概念
2.3.2 控制面板
2.3.3 文件管理器
2.3.4 域用戶管理器
2.3.5 服務(wù)器管理器
2.3.6 打印管理器
2.3.7 系統(tǒng)維護
第3章 數(shù)據(jù)庫基本原理
3.1 數(shù)據(jù)庫基本概念
3.1.1 數(shù)據(jù)、數(shù)據(jù)庫
3.1.2 數(shù)據(jù)庫管理系統(tǒng)
3.1.3 數(shù)據(jù)庫語言
3.1.4 數(shù)據(jù)庫系統(tǒng)
3.2 數(shù)據(jù)庫系統(tǒng)的特征
3.3 數(shù)據(jù)庫系統(tǒng)的結(jié)構(gòu)與數(shù)據(jù)獨立性
3.3.1 數(shù)據(jù)庫系統(tǒng)結(jié)構(gòu)
3.3.2 數(shù)據(jù)獨立性
3.3.3 數(shù)據(jù)庫操作過程
3.4 數(shù)據(jù)模型
3.4.1 主要數(shù)據(jù)模型
3.4.2 數(shù)據(jù)模型要素
3.5 關(guān)系數(shù)據(jù)庫
3.5.1 關(guān)系模型
3.5.2 關(guān)系模型的完整性
3.6 數(shù)據(jù)庫安全與恢復
3.6.1 數(shù)據(jù)庫的安全性
3.6.2 數(shù)據(jù)庫的恢復
第4章 查詢語言SQL與數(shù)據(jù)庫設(shè)計
4.1 結(jié)構(gòu)化查詢語言SQL
4.1.1 SQL的數(shù)據(jù)定義語句
4.1.2 SQL的數(shù)據(jù)操作語句
4.1.3 SQl的數(shù)據(jù)控制語句
4.1.4 SQl的數(shù)據(jù)嵌入式使用
4.2 關(guān)系數(shù)據(jù)庫設(shè)計理論
4.2.1 關(guān)系數(shù)據(jù)庫設(shè)計理論的
主要內(nèi)容
4.2.2 函數(shù)依賴
4.2.3 關(guān)系模式的規(guī)范化理論
4.3 數(shù)據(jù)庫設(shè)計
4.3.1 系統(tǒng)規(guī)劃
4.3.2 系統(tǒng)的需求分析
4.3.3 數(shù)據(jù)庫的概念設(shè)計
4.3.4 數(shù)據(jù)庫的邏輯設(shè)計
4.3.5 數(shù)據(jù)庫的物理設(shè)計
4.3.6 數(shù)據(jù)庫的實施
第5章 數(shù)據(jù)庫管理系統(tǒng)ORACLE及其工具軟件
5.1 SQL語言
5.1.1 SQL概述
5.1.2 數(shù)據(jù)查詢語句(SELECT語句)
5.1.3 數(shù)據(jù)操縱語句(DML
5.1.4 數(shù)據(jù)定義語句(DDL)
5.1.5 事務(wù)控制語句
5.2 PL/SQL
5.2.1 PL/SQL的優(yōu)點
5.2.2 PL/SQL塊
5.2.3 控制結(jié)構(gòu)
5.2.4 游標管理
5.2.5 出錯處理
5.2.6 子程序
5.2.7 包
5.2.8 數(shù)據(jù)庫觸發(fā)器
5.3 ORACLE數(shù)據(jù)庫結(jié)構(gòu)性能及特點
5.3.1 ORACLE數(shù)據(jù)庫系統(tǒng)的體系結(jié)構(gòu)
5.3.2 數(shù)據(jù)字典
5.3.3 數(shù)據(jù)類型
5.3.4 ORACLERDBMS的性能特點
5.4 數(shù)據(jù)庫管理
5.4.1 ORACLE的體系結(jié)構(gòu)
5.4.2 數(shù)據(jù)庫的啟動和關(guān)閉
5.4.3 建立數(shù)據(jù)庫
5.4.4 物理結(jié)構(gòu)的管理和維護
5.4.5 邏輯結(jié)構(gòu)的管理和維護
5.4.6 數(shù)據(jù)完整性管理和維護
5.4.7 并發(fā)性管理
5.4.8 用戶管理及維護
5.4.9 權(quán)限的管理及維護
5.4.10 系統(tǒng)安全性管理
5.5 備份與恢復
5.5.1 備份的策略
5.5.2 備份的方法
5.5.3 恢復的方法
5.6 客戶機/服務(wù)器連接
5.6.1 客戶機的配置
5.6.2 服務(wù)器的配置
5.6.3 SQL,NET的使用
5.6.4 客戶機/服務(wù)器的連接
5.6.5 服務(wù)器/服務(wù)器的連接
5.7 應(yīng)用開發(fā)工具
5.7.1 Developer/2000技術(shù)和部件
5.7.2 Developer/2000Forms
5.7.3 Developer/2000Reports
5.7.4 Developer/2000Graphics
第6章 數(shù)據(jù)庫管理系統(tǒng)SYBASE及其應(yīng)用
開發(fā)工具
6.1 SYBASE數(shù)據(jù)庫系統(tǒng)概述
6.1.1 SYBASE 客戶機/服務(wù)器體系結(jié)構(gòu)
6.1.2 SYBASE客戶機/服務(wù)器數(shù)據(jù)庫環(huán)境
6.1.3 SYBASE客戶機/服務(wù)器軟件組成及其功能和性能特點
6.2 SYBASEAdaptiveServer基本框架及系統(tǒng)安裝
6.2.1 系統(tǒng)數(shù)據(jù)庫
6.2.2 系統(tǒng)表――數(shù)據(jù)字典
6.2.3 SYBASE系統(tǒng)存儲過程
6.2.4 SYBASE軟件目錄結(jié)構(gòu)
6.2.5 接口文件
6.2.6 環(huán)境變量
6.2.7 Server運行文件
6.2.8 SYBASESQLServer配置文件
6.2.9 SYBASESQLServer的啟動和關(guān)閉
6.2.10 SYBASESQlServer的出錯日志
6.2.11 SYBASESQLServer操作環(huán)境
6.2.12 SYBASESQLServer安裝步驟
6.3 SYBASE數(shù)據(jù)庫語言T-SQL概述
6.3.1 事務(wù)型結(jié)構(gòu)化查詢語言T-SQL
6.3.2 TSQl標識符及數(shù)據(jù)庫對象命名
6.3.3 TSQL的使用方法
6.3.4 SYBASESQLServer的數(shù)據(jù)類型
6.3.5 SYBASESQLServer函數(shù)
6.3.6 SYBASESQLServer的表達式
6.4 T-SQL的數(shù)據(jù)操縱語言― 數(shù)據(jù)修改與查詢
6.4.1 使用不同的數(shù)據(jù)庫
6.4.2 插入數(shù)據(jù)
6.4.3 更新數(shù)據(jù)
6.4.4 刪除數(shù)據(jù)
6.4.5 T-SQL的數(shù)據(jù)查詢
6.5 T-SQL的數(shù)據(jù)庫定義語言創(chuàng)建數(shù)據(jù)庫對象(I)
6.5.1 用戶定義數(shù)據(jù)類型
6.5.2 一般表
6.5.3 索引
6.5.4 視圖
6.5.5 缺省
6.5.6 規(guī)則
6.5.7 數(shù)據(jù)庫完整性與帶有聲明完整性約束的表
6.6 T-SQl的程序設(shè)計功能
6.6.1 批和注釋代碼
6.6.2 局部變量和全局變量
6.6.3 顯示提示消息
6.6.4 流控制關(guān)鍵字
6.6.5 游標
6.7 數(shù)據(jù)庫定義語句――創(chuàng)建數(shù)據(jù)庫對象(Ⅱ)
6.7.1 存儲過程
6.7.2 觸發(fā)器
6.7.3 SYBASESQLServer數(shù)據(jù)庫對象小結(jié)
6.8 SYBASE數(shù)據(jù)庫系統(tǒng)管理和系統(tǒng)管理工具
6.8.1 SYBASE數(shù)據(jù)庫系統(tǒng)管理
6.8.2 SYBASE系統(tǒng)管理工具
6.9 資源管理
6.9.1 設(shè)備的建立和刪除
6.9.2 設(shè)備的使用
6.10 用戶和權(quán)限管理
6.10.1 SybaseSQ LServer中的用戶
6.10.2 SybaseSQLServer三種角色的權(quán)力
6.10.3 SybaseSQLServer中的用戶管理
6.10.4 SybaseSQLServer的權(quán)限管理
6.11 SYBASESQLServer基本配置參數(shù)調(diào)整
6.11.1 缺省配置參數(shù)
6.11.2 配置參數(shù)的調(diào)整
6.11.3 配置文件
6.11.4 配置參數(shù)的顯示級別及其設(shè)置
6.11.5 SYBASESQLServer內(nèi)存的使用和配置
6.12 事務(wù)管理和數(shù)據(jù)庫的備份與恢復
6.12.1 事務(wù)、事務(wù)日志和檢查點
6.12.2 事務(wù)管理
6.12.3 使用事務(wù)日志恢復數(shù)據(jù)庫
6.12.4 日志管理
6.12.5 數(shù)據(jù)庫和事務(wù)的備份與恢復
6.13 SYBASE SQLServer的監(jiān)控與排錯
6.13.1 監(jiān)控SYBASESQLServer的使用情況
6.13.2 監(jiān)控空間的使用情況
6.13.3 檢驗數(shù)據(jù)庫的一致性
6.13.4 監(jiān)控SYBASESQLServer的總體活動
6.13.5 制定一個監(jiān)控計劃
6.13.6 SQLServer的排錯
6.13.7 性能調(diào)整
6.14 PowerBuilder
6.14.1 PowerBuilder概述
6.14.2 PowerBuilder對象的創(chuàng)建與畫筆
第7章 數(shù)據(jù)庫管理系統(tǒng)INFORMIX及其工具
7.1 INFORMIX基礎(chǔ)知識
7.1.1 ONLINE體系結(jié)構(gòu)
7.1.2 ONLINE基本概念
7.2 ONLINE數(shù)據(jù)庫管理
7.2.1 數(shù)據(jù)類型
7.2.2 創(chuàng)建數(shù)據(jù)庫、表、索引、視圖
7.2.3 并發(fā)控制
7.2.4 數(shù)據(jù)完整性
7.2.5 數(shù)據(jù)安全性
7.3 1NFORMIXESQL/C程序開發(fā)
7.3.1 ESQL/C概述
7.3.2 ESQL/C編程
7.3.3 ESQL/C中常用SQL語句的異常檢測
7.3.4 游標的定義和使用
7.3.5 動態(tài)SQL語句
7.4 INFORMIX―4GL程序開發(fā)
7.4.1 概述
7.4.2 程序變量及其類型
7.4.3 INFO)RMIX-4GL程序的語句
7.4.4 游標的使用
7.4.5 異常檢測
7.4.6 INFORMIX-4GL程序開發(fā)工具
第8章 數(shù)據(jù)庫系統(tǒng)的實施與維護
8.1 應(yīng)用程序調(diào)試
8.1.1 軟件測試的基本概念
8.1.2 程序測試技術(shù)
8.1.3 程序排錯方法
8.1.4 測試與排錯
8.2 數(shù)據(jù)庫數(shù)據(jù)的加載
8.2.1 數(shù)據(jù)加載的準備
8.2.2 數(shù)據(jù)加載的方法
8.2.3 數(shù)據(jù)加載正確性保證
8.3 數(shù)據(jù)庫的試運行
8.3.1 數(shù)據(jù)庫試運行的準備
8.3.2 數(shù)據(jù)庫試運行的任務(wù)
8.3.3 數(shù)據(jù)庫試運行的實施
8.4 數(shù)據(jù)庫系統(tǒng)的運行與維護
8.4.1 數(shù)據(jù)庫系統(tǒng)性能問題及優(yōu)化技術(shù)
8.4.2 數(shù)據(jù)庫空間存儲及碎片重組
8.4.3 數(shù)據(jù)庫管理員(DBA)實用技術(shù)
8.4.4 數(shù)據(jù)快速卸載及恢復技術(shù)
8.4.5 系統(tǒng)安全性管理
第9章 數(shù)據(jù)庫的發(fā)展動向
9.1 數(shù)據(jù)庫的客戶機/服務(wù)器的結(jié)構(gòu)
9.1.1 客戶機/服務(wù)器的基本概念
9.1.2 客戶機/服務(wù)器結(jié)構(gòu)的數(shù)據(jù)庫管理系統(tǒng)
9.2 分布式數(shù)據(jù)庫系統(tǒng)
9.2.1 分布式數(shù)據(jù)庫系統(tǒng)的定義
9.2.2 分布式數(shù)據(jù)庫系統(tǒng)的特點
9.2.3 分布式數(shù)據(jù)庫系統(tǒng)的結(jié)構(gòu)
9.2.4 分布式數(shù)據(jù)庫管理系統(tǒng)
9.3 并行數(shù)據(jù)庫系統(tǒng)
9.3.1 并行數(shù)據(jù)庫基本概念
9.3.2 并行數(shù)據(jù)庫系統(tǒng)的功能
9.3.3 并行數(shù)據(jù)庫的結(jié)構(gòu)
9.3.4 并行數(shù)據(jù)庫的并行處理技術(shù)
圖書封面
評論、評分、閱讀與下載
數(shù)據(jù)庫技術(shù)中級培訓教程 PDF格式下載